Intel Core i7-6700K testing with a ASUS MAXIMUS VIII HERO and Intel HD 530 on Arch rolling via the Phoronix Test Suite.

C-Ray

This is a test of C-Ray, a simple raytracer designed to test the floating-point CPU performance. This test is multi-threaded (16 threads per core), will shoot 8 rays per pixel for anti-aliasing, and will generate a 1600 x 1200 image. Learn more via the OpenBenchmarking.org test page.
